Description
Why rent when you can own this spacious alcove studio located on a beautiful tree-lined block in Sutton Place. This corner unit with Northeast exposure gets excellent light all day long. The alcove studio is large enough for a queen-size bed with plenty of room for a home office and four large closets.
Other notable highlights of this residence include hardwood floors, through the wall A/C for year-round comfort, and a separate kitchen.
345 east 54th Street is an intimate co-op with easy access to all transportation, wonderful shopping, restaurants, gourmet shops, supermarkets, and gyms nearby. The building has an elevator, live-in super, laundry room, and a video intercom system. The co-op allows unlimited subletting after 5 years of ownership and 80% financing.
Pets are allowed with board approval. Sorry, pieds-a-terre are not allowed.
Special assessment of $134.55 per month through December 2023.
